Care and Maintenance
Proper care ensures the longevity and optimal performance of your DVD.
- Handling: Always hold the DVD by its edges or by placing a finger through the center hole. Avoid touching the shiny playback surface.
- Cleaning: If the disc becomes dirty or smudged, gently wipe it with a soft, lint-free cloth. Wipe from the center of the disc outwards in a straight line, not in a circular motion. Do not use abrasive cleaners or solvents.
- Storage: Store the DVD in its original case, away from direct sunlight, extreme temperatures, and high humidity.
- Avoid Scratches: Do not bend the disc or expose it to sharp objects that could scratch the surface.
